Transaction 0742e81f8fdcd4e8b844cba7503f1ebea8ec63fa1cda9f247bcc5b58e2067947
3 Input
2 Outputs
- 0742e81f8fdcd4e8b844cba7503f1ebea8ec63fa1cda9f247bcc5b58e2067947:0
- 0742e81f8fdcd4e8b844cba7503f1ebea8ec63fa1cda9f247bcc5b58e2067947:1
value 847431
address 1DuRazzGgE2ELTys6Q1nQ2yZSo8wWcn6J2
value 20950991
address 1NEqTfmYtbprnEwvagPBAmLpxs7FgqYgH4